Handover: LockerLink access flow, from Davor to whoever inherits this. The unlock path hits the Spinwash kiosk gateway first, then falls back to PIN entry if the NFC handshake times out. Don't touch the retry window without testing against the Hollowbrook site's flaky readers. Token refresh runs hourly via cron on the edge box. Logs go to the usual aggregator. The current production settings for the gateway are listed below.

settings of tagef-bawif:
DRUIX_HOST=druix.zemvarlabs.internal
DRUIX_PORT=8000

# Client setup for the Nightloom backfill scheduler.
# Every nightly backfill job authenticates against the internal
# Ledgerpipe service before claiming a partition. As a contractor,
# you should never generate your own credentials; the shared
# scheduler key is managed by the platform team and rotated
# quarterly. The current value is provided below.

app token of badug-tahaf = qvz11-nP5FBNr8qnh

Action item from the Portage API postmortem: pagination on the public REST API used offset-based paging, so clients skipped or duplicated records whenever rows were inserted mid-scan. We are switching all list endpoints to opaque cursors; offset params will be accepted but ignored after the deprecation window. Contractors touching list endpoints must follow the cursor spec. The spec and migration checklist are on the page below.

wiki page, fajof-tajef: https://vault.tolvaqio.corp/board/pipeline/pages/ticket/c20d7f984bcc9e12

Leadership Review Briefing — For Incoming Director

Legacy customers on the Cairnline platform have not seen a price change in four years. We propose a phased increase over two renewal cycles, with grandfathering for the top twenty accounts. Churn modeling suggests modest attrition, offset within two quarters. Support will receive talking points before notices go out. The confidential pricing schedule appears below.

board note of kageg-bahof: The renewal with Holwynax Holdings closes at $2 million a year, 5 percent below the last contract. Project Ulaath slips by two quarters because of the supplier delay.